Output 3f975964630192fbc18416f76de9db34c76ae1930c14a11f9a8781b436c3cdf9:0

value
730087
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09c0c959e60f44d4541a705e11d8a4206a041628 OP_EQUAL
address
32aaxK7GJmPCqfN8fbe3Z26wQyWm45fvCS
transaction
3f975964630192fbc18416f76de9db34c76ae1930c14a11f9a8781b436c3cdf9
confirmations
283625
spent
true